    I too have no complaints. We have just narrowly lost a play off final after a positive season. We have so far lost one player who most accepted we would loose this summer anyway. Our coach has gone (not the clubs fault), we have taken time to get the right man in, if it’s today which it looks like it will be, he has a month to work with the players. We’ve already made two signings for first team. We have been assured our star men won’t be sold this summer and as they under long term contracts I imagine that to be the case. Hoping for a coach announcement today or tomorrow and we need at least one striker and maybe a bit of depth at fullback and midfield. Our youth teams are doing brilliantly. Don’t know why some people are acting like this summer is a complete disaster. We have had far far far worse off seasons. Whoever comes in is inheriting a good squad
